FX3/CX3 CyU3PMutex

来源:互联网 发布:pkpm施工技术软件 编辑:程序博客网 时间:2024/05/17 22:11

1 . 定义

CyU3PMutex SharedMutex;                 // Used to control access to a shared resource

2 . 初始化

 Status = CyU3PMutexCreate(&SharedMutex, CYU3P_INHERIT);    //Whether priority inheritance should be allowed for this mutex. Allowed values for this parameter//are CYU3P_NO_INHERIT and CYU3P_INHERIT.

3 . 使用

CyU3PReturnStatus_t Status;Status = CyU3PMutexGet(&SharedMutex, CYU3P_WAIT_FOREVER);   //获取Status = CyU3PMutexPut(&SharedMutex);//释放
原创粉丝点击